The Central Information Commission (CIC) in India was formed on October 12, 2005, following the enactment of the Right to Information Act (RTI) earlier that year. The commission was established to oversee the implementation of the RTI Act and to address appeals and complaints regarding information requests made to public authorities. The CIC plays a crucial role in promoting transparency and accountability in government operations.

The Right to Information Act was passed in June 2005 in India in order to set up a structure whereby citizens can request (and receive) information in a consistent manner and a reasonable amount of time.
